[SMM Analysis] Imported Aluminum Scrap Rebounds; Southeast Asia Scrap Stable, ADC12 FOB Edges Higher
The Southeast Asian secondary aluminum market remained broadly stable this week. Aluminum scrap prices moved within a narrow range, while ADC12 domestic prices were largely unchanged and FOB offers edged higher on firm raw material costs. Meanwhile, imported aluminum scrap prices in China continued to rebound as import margins improved, with several cargoes reportedly scheduled to arrive in mid-August, providing additional support to market sentiment.
